// Client setup for Graphtrawl, the dependency graph visualizer.
// Talks to the internal Edgeforge index service. Read-only scope.
// Don't widen scopes without asking the platform lead.
// Timeouts are deliberate — the index is slow on cold cache.
// Contractors: use the shared dev credential, never personal tokens.
// The client authenticates with the key on the next line.

app token of yajeg-kawef = kto11_7En3XSX8xQw

FAQ — Basement Archive Room Access (Night Shift)

Q: How do I access the archive room after hours?
A: The archive room (B-04, Dunmoor Wing basement) is unstaffed overnight. Take the east stairwell, as the lift is locked out after 22:00. Sign the paper register inside the door and relock on exit. Enter using the night-shift code below.

door code, yagap-bahof: bdg-O-05

## Formula sandbox tuning

User-supplied formulas in Gridmoor execute inside a restricted interpreter with hard ceilings on time, memory, and call depth. Reviewers should confirm any change to these ceilings is justified in the PR description, since raising them widens the abuse surface. Defaults were chosen from production traces. The current limits are as follows.

limits module of tafog-fawip:
WEIGHTS = {
    "julix": 57,
    "lamys": 992,
    "kasvan": 209,
    "quenok": 750,
    "alddor": 259,
    "oliath": 1009,
    "wenix": 815,
}